    Excellent Full time and Part time OB Hospitalist Opportunity – Easy Access to Madison, Milwaukee and Chicago

    Mercyhealth is actively seeking 2 dedicated OB Hospitalists—one Full-time and one Part-time—to join our esteemed team at Mercyhealth Hospital and Trauma Center in Janesville, Wisconsin.

    As an integrated healthcare provider, we pride ourselves on delivering exceptional and coordinated care across four core service divisions:
    hospital-based services, clinic-based services, post-acute care and retail services, and a wholly owned insurance company.

    It is this seamless integration that sets Mercyhealth apart, allowing us to address the complete spectrum of healthcare needs for our patients.

    This system is the backbone of our commitment to providing outstanding healthcare services. At Mercyhealth, we have garnered awards for our excellence in healthcare delivery.

    Our multi-regional, integrated health system encompasses 7 hospitals, boasts a team of over 800 employed physicians, operates more than 85 outpatient clinics, and extends its care to residents in over 55 communities throughout northern Illinois and southern Wisconsin.

    Our dedication to healthcare excellence is evident in the extensive range of services we offer—over 125 specialty and sub-specialty services, including critical care for adults and pediatrics, neonatal intensive care, cutting-edge neurosurgery, comprehensive heart and vascular care, advanced cancer treatments, plastic and reconstructive surgery, da Vinci robotic surgery, and much more.

    Embrace a rewarding full-time hospital-employed position.
    Engage in rounding and discharge responsibilities on both postpartum and antepartum units.
    Collaborate with a core group of doctors, offering valuable assistance in C-sections.
    Enjoy spacious, aesthetically pleasing labor and delivery suites and recovery rooms.
    12-hour shifts from 7 pm to 7 am, Monday to Friday.
    Utilize EPIC EMR for efficient and seamless healthcare documentation.
    Exclusive 12-hour night shifts for OB hospitalists on Saturdays, Sundays, and holidays.
    Team rotation for day shifts on weekends and holidays to cover the full spectrum of care.
    Extend expertise to cover GYN cases from the ED, managing emergencies with the same proficiency as current practices.
    Choose a full-time commitment with a structured 7 nights on, 7 nights off schedule.
    Opt for a half-time commitment with a balanced 7 nights on, 21 nights off schedule.

    Community:
    Janesville, Wisconsin is a mid-sized city offering a safe, family-oriented community with excellent schools and abundant recreational opportunities.

    Janesville is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ts, boasting a network of trails, recreational areas, and parks that cater to various interests.

    Residents and visitors alike can enjoy leisurely strolls along the riverbanks, explore hiking trails, or partake in water activities on the Rock River.
